mcp-server-grok-chat

An MCP (Model Context Protocol) server for the xAI Grok API. Built in Rust, exposes chat completions, vision, web/X search, embeddings, and model listing as MCP tools.

Communicates via stdio using JSON-RPC 2.0, like all MCP servers.

chat

Send a chat completion request. Supports multi-turn conversations via a JSON message history array, system prompts, structured output via JSON schema, temperature control, model selection, and multi-agent research.

When using a multi-agent model (any model ID containing multi-agent), the request is automatically routed through the Responses API. The multi-agent model dispatches your query to multiple agents that research in parallel, then synthesizes their findings. Use reasoning_effort to control agent count. Call the list_models tool to see which multi-agent models are currently available.

Prerequisites

Setup

Create the config file:

mkdir -p ~/.config/mcp-server-grok-chat

Create ~/.config/mcp-server-grok-chat/config.toml:

api_key = "xai-..."

Build

cargo build --release

This produces target/release/grok-chat.

For development:

cargo build              # debug build
cargo run                # run in dev mode
RUST_LOG=debug cargo run # run with debug logging

MCP Configuration

Add to your Claude Desktop config (~/.config/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json):

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"grok-chat": {
      "command": "/path/to/grok-chat"
    }
  }
}

Project Structure

src/
  main.rs    - entry point, config loading, stdio transport setup
  server.rs  - MCP tool definitions (chat, chat_with_vision, chat_with_search, embedding, list_models)
  api.rs     - xAI HTTP client, request/response types, response formatters
  params.rs  - tool parameter types with serde and JSON Schema derives
  config.rs  - TOML config loading
